                   31.5 Summary

                    •  Teleconferencing or distance communication system can be defined as a communication system in

                       which two or more people sitting at distant place can communicate through some electronic medium
                       in the similar manner as they are communicating with each other by sitting in front of each other.
                    •  Teleconferencing or teleconference is a real-time interaction between two or more people.
                       Teleconferencing is that electronic system, in which two or more people at distant locations can
                       participate in the discussion of  their desired topics.
